In the winter months, spectator sport in Northern BC communities means hockey and sled-dog racing. From September to March, hockey fans can cheer on teams at the Coliseum or the Multiplex in Prince George. The city is home to a the Spruce Kings (BC Hockey League) and Cougars (Western Hockey League).

Dog enthusiasts will want to view the Telkwa Gold Sled Dog Championships, held just outside Telkwa as well as the Canadian Open Championship that has been running for over 40 years in Fort Nelson. Both are two-day events.
